From 4050cfebdaa001d498c396f24dd67771541b710e Mon Sep 17 00:00:00 2001 From: YuheiOKAWA Date: Mon, 10 Oct 2016 10:24:42 +0900 Subject: ramips: add support for Planex VR500. SOC: MT7621A RAM: 256MiB NOR: MX25L51245G Non Wireless Router. Issue: soft reboot problem. SPI Flash do not exit 4byte address mode. Signed-off-by: Yuhei Okawa --- target/linux/ramips/base-files/etc/board.d/01_leds | 3 ++- target/linux/ramips/base-files/etc/board.d/02_network | 5 +++++ target/linux/ramips/base-files/etc/diag.sh | 1 + target/linux/ramips/base-files/lib/ramips.sh | 3 +++ target/linux/ramips/base-files/lib/upgrade/platform.sh | 1 + 5 files changed, 12 insertions(+), 1 deletion(-) (limited to 'target/linux/ramips/base-files') diff --git a/target/linux/ramips/base-files/etc/board.d/01_leds b/target/linux/ramips/base-files/etc/board.d/01_leds index e14448e3f2..4b66694ed9 100755 --- a/target/linux/ramips/base-files/etc/board.d/01_leds +++ b/target/linux/ramips/base-files/etc/board.d/01_leds @@ -146,7 +146,8 @@ mzk-ex300np) ;; dir-810l|\ mzk-750dhp|\ -mzk-dp150n) +mzk-dp150n|\ +vr500) ucidef_set_led_default "power" "power" "$board:green:power" "1" ;; dir-860l-b1) diff --git a/target/linux/ramips/base-files/etc/board.d/02_network b/target/linux/ramips/base-files/etc/board.d/02_network index 0400e58cda..99c90e4590 100755 --- a/target/linux/ramips/base-files/etc/board.d/02_network +++ b/target/linux/ramips/base-files/etc/board.d/02_network @@ -85,6 +85,7 @@ ramips_setup_interfaces() psg1218|\ sap-g3200u3|\ sk-wb8|\ + vr500|\ wf-2881|\ whr-300hp2|\ whr-600d|\ @@ -354,6 +355,10 @@ ramips_setup_macs() lan_mac=$(mtd_get_mac_ascii u-boot-env LAN_MAC_ADDR) wan_mac=$(mtd_get_mac_ascii u-boot-env WAN_MAC_ADDR) ;; + vr500) + lan_mac=$(mtd_get_mac_binary factory 57344) + wan_mac=$(mtd_get_mac_binary factory 57350) + ;; w306r-v20) lan_mac=$(cat /sys/class/net/eth0/address) wan_mac=$(macaddr_add "$lan_mac" 5) diff --git a/target/linux/ramips/base-files/etc/diag.sh b/target/linux/ramips/base-files/etc/diag.sh index 67dcf99a00..84459a5c01 100644 --- a/target/linux/ramips/base-files/etc/diag.sh +++ b/target/linux/ramips/base-files/etc/diag.sh @@ -29,6 +29,7 @@ get_status_led() { nbg-419n|\ nbg-419n2|\ pwh2004|\ + vr500|\ wnce2001|\ wndr3700v5|\ x5|\ diff --git a/target/linux/ramips/base-files/lib/ramips.sh b/target/linux/ramips/base-files/lib/ramips.sh index d57c1cf922..526a5ae669 100755 --- a/target/linux/ramips/base-files/lib/ramips.sh +++ b/target/linux/ramips/base-files/lib/ramips.sh @@ -442,6 +442,9 @@ ramips_board_detect() { *"VoCore") name="vocore" ;; + *"VR500") + name="vr500" + ;; *"W150M") name="w150m" ;; diff --git a/target/linux/ramips/base-files/lib/upgrade/platform.sh b/target/linux/ramips/base-files/lib/upgrade/platform.sh index 806c1a0e8c..9c49c8070d 100755 --- a/target/linux/ramips/base-files/lib/upgrade/platform.sh +++ b/target/linux/ramips/base-files/lib/upgrade/platform.sh @@ -128,6 +128,7 @@ platform_check_image() { ur-336un|\ v22rw-2x2|\ vocore|\ + vr500|\ w150m|\ w306r-v20|\ w502u|\ -- cgit v1.2.3